NK Vrapče

NK Vrapče Zagreb is a Croatian football club based in the Zagreb district Podsused - Vrapče.

History

Founded in 1938 under the name NK Vrapče Zagreb, the club merged after interim renamed NK Mladost due to financial difficulties in 1966 with NK Zagreb Sparta. After renaming the new association in 1977 in Sparta Elektra and simplifying internal squabbles, in 1979 the re-establishment as Sportsko Društvo Vrapče (German Sport camaraderie Vrapče ) with the departments football, handball, karate, table tennis and shooting. Since then, there was a fundamental renewal of the association and the infrastructure.

After the secession of Croatia from Yugoslavia Vrapče Zagreb took in the season 1992/93 for the first time in the game operating the second highest league in the country in part: After the descent to the fourth division in the second half of the 1990s succeeded in 2002, the rise in the third league. First, the mid- season associated Vrapče Zagreb has been part of the restructuring of the third division in the year 2006 squadron West.
